drjobs PostgreSQL Database Administrator

PostgreSQL Database Administrator

Employer Active

1 Vacancy
drjobs

Job Alert

You will be updated with latest job alerts via email
Valid email field required
Send jobs
Send me jobs like this
drjobs

Job Alert

You will be updated with latest job alerts via email

Valid email field required
Send jobs
Job Location drjobs

Nashville, TN - USA

Monthly Salary drjobs

Not Disclosed

drjobs

Salary Not Disclosed

Vacancy

1 Vacancy

Job Description

Title: PostgreSQL Database Administrator

Location: Nashville TN/Day 1onsite

Required Skills

  • Minimum of 10 years of strong and relevant experience as a PostgreSQL Database Administrator specifically for large scale applications.
  • Extensive experience with AWS RDS Postgres including setup configuration and management.
  • Strong knowledge of PostgreSQL architecture configuration and administration.
  • Minimum of 8 years of handson experience developing and reviewing complex PL/pgSQL functions procedures and other database objects.
  • Extensive experience with database performance tuning and optimization techniques.
  • Proficiency in SQL and PL/pgSQL programming.
  • Familiarity with database security best practices.
  • Experience with backup and recovery strategies.
  • Strong problemsolving skills and attention to detail.
  • Excellent communication and collaboration skills.
  • Ability to work independently and as part of a team.
  • Flexibility in working hours to support global teams and critical database operations.
  • Must have experience in production system monitoring and incident management processes.
  • Must provide afterhours oncall support.
  • Experience in designing database schemas access patterns and locking strategies.
  • Experience in conducting performance analysis and capacity planning.
  • Familiarity with DevOps practices and tools (e.g. Bitbucket Bamboo Github Jenkinks).

Preferred Skills

Knowledge of other database systems (e.g. MySQL Oracle).

Commitment to continuous learning and staying updated with new technologies and industry trends.

Experience working with large scale database models related to health and human services applications is considered a big plus.

Responsibilities:

  • We are seeking a highly experienced Postgres Database Administrator with a minimum of 10 years of strong and relevant experience.
  • This extensive experience is critical for architecting designing setting up and managing large scale application database systems having complex database structures. The successful applicant should have a proven track record of administrating PostgreSQL databases specifically within AWS RDS environments.
  • This role demands a proactive individual who can manage maintain and optimize our database systems to ensure high availability and performance especially in environments with more than 2000 tables across multiple schemas.
  • The ability to quickly understand application database models and entity relationships and to start demonstrating DBA skillsets in a fastpaced project environment is essential. Amazon RDS flips role as a DBA around so you spend only a fraction of your time on routine management tasks.
  • This leaves the rest of your time for aligning your work more closely with the business and value derived from the data assets that you manage.
  • You can then focus on lending your DBA skills to application teams and end usershelping deliver new features functionality and proactive tuning value to the core business.

Setup and Configuration:

  • Architect design and implement PostgreSQL databases on AWS RDS ensuring optimal configuration for performance and scalability.
  • Configure parameter groups option groups and security groups for AWS RDS Postgres instances.
  • Configure and manage database users roles and
  • Set up and manage database instances including multiAZ deployments for high availability.
  • Implement automated backups snapshots and point in time recovery configurations.
  • Configure monitoring and alerting using AWS CloudWatch and other monitoring tools.

Database Management:

  • Manage and maintain PostgreSQL databases with more than 2000 tables across multiple schemas.
  • Ensure data is available protected from loss and corruption and easily accessible.
  • Perform database tuning optimization and troubleshooting to ensure high performance and availability.
  • Implement and manage database security measures including user access controls and data encryption.
  • Develop and maintain database backup and recovery procedures.
  • Follow operation run books to ensure consistent and reliable database operations.
  • Schema Design and Access Patterns:
  • Design database schemas access patterns and locking strategies to ensure data integrity and optimal performance.

Scripting and Automation:

Extensive experience with writing shell/bash/Python scripts related to Postgres DB management and automation.

Develop and maintain scripts for automating routine database tasks and processes

Employment Type

Full Time

Company Industry

About Company

Report This Job
Disclaimer: Drjobpro.com is only a platform that connects job seekers and employers. Applicants are advised to conduct their own independent research into the credentials of the prospective employer.We always make certain that our clients do not endorse any request for money payments, thus we advise against sharing any personal or bank-related information with any third party. If you suspect fraud or malpractice, please contact us via contact us page.